The MCSA 2016 certification is tailored to validate the skills and knowledge required to effectively manage and implement Microsoft Server 2016 solutions. This certification, divided into multiple exams, assesses an individual’s ability to perform various tasks related to Windows Server 2016, demonstrating a comprehensive understanding of Microsoft’s server technologies.

To embark on the journey towards MCSA 2016 certification, individuals typically undertake a series of exams, each focusing on specific aspects of Windows Server 2016. These exams encompass a range of topics, from installation and configuration to networking, storage, and virtualization. The certification process is designed not only to evaluate theoretical knowledge but also to assess the practical application of skills in real-world scenarios.

One of the core exams associated with MCSA 2016 is the “Installation, Storage, and Compute with Windows Server 2016.” This exam delves into the fundamental aspects of deploying and managing Windows Server 2016 infrastructure. It covers a spectrum of topics, including server installation, server roles and features, storage solutions, and Hyper-V implementation. Successful completion of this exam signifies a candidate’s adeptness in foundational server administration tasks.

Another integral component of the MCSA 2016 certification is the “Networking with Windows Server 2016” exam. Networking is a critical aspect of any server environment, and this exam evaluates an individual’s proficiency in implementing and managing networking solutions in Windows Server 2016. Topics covered include DNS, DHCP, remote access solutions, and advanced network infrastructure.

The third key exam in the MCSA 2016 certification path is the “Identity with Windows Server 2016.” Identity management is a crucial facet of server administration, and this exam assesses a candidate’s ability to deploy and manage Active Directory Domain Services (AD DS), Group Policy, and other identity-related functionalities.
